首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Node.js SyntaxError:设置伪造查看器时出现意外标识符

是指在使用Node.js时发生了语法错误,具体是在设置伪造查看器时遇到了意外的标识符。语法错误是指代码不符合编程语言的语法规则,因此无法被正确解析和执行。

要解决这个问题,我们需要检查代码中的语法错误,并修复它们。下面是一些常见的语法错误和可能导致该错误的原因:

  1. 拼写错误:检查代码中是否存在拼写错误,例如错误的变量名或函数名。
  2. 缺少或多余的括号、引号或分号:检查代码中的括号、引号和分号是否成对出现,缺少或多余这些符号都会导致语法错误。
  3. 不正确的语句顺序:确保代码中的语句按照正确的顺序排列,例如在声明变量之前使用变量会导致语法错误。
  4. 语法错误的表达式或操作符:检查代码中的表达式和操作符是否正确使用,例如使用了未定义的变量或错误的运算符。

关于伪造查看器的具体意图和实现方式,我无法根据提供的问答内容进行详细说明。但是,根据你的描述,我可以提供一些有关Node.js和错误处理的一般性建议:

  1. 确保在代码中使用正确的语法,并进行严格的语法检查。
  2. 使用开发工具(如IDE或编辑器插件)来帮助你捕捉和修复语法错误。
  3. 阅读和理解Node.js的官方文档,以了解正确的语法和错误处理方法。
  4. 在编写代码之前,先进行测试和调试,以确保代码的正确性。
  5. 在遇到问题时,使用Node.js的调试工具来逐步排查错误,如Node.js调试器(node inspect)或Chrome开发者工具的Node.js调试支持。

需要注意的是,在回答这个问题时,我无法提及腾讯云的相关产品和链接地址,因此无法为你提供具体的腾讯云产品推荐。但是,腾讯云作为一家云计算服务提供商,提供了丰富的云计算产品和解决方案,你可以在腾讯云官方网站上了解更多相关信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

2015826 Python基础(1):基本规则及赋值「建议收藏」

File "", line 1 y = (x = x + 1) ^ SyntaxError: invalid syntax >>> if (a = 3): SyntaxError: invalid...File "", line 1 y = (x = x + 1) ^ SyntaxError: invalid syntax >>> if (a = 3): SyntaxError: invalid...使用多元赋值的方法可以不使用中间变量直接交换表量的值 >>> x , y = 1, 2 >>> x, y (1, 2) >>> x, y = y, x >>> x, y (2, 1) 专用下划线标识符...当对象被创建并赋值给变量,该对象的引用计数就被设置为 1 当同一个对象又被赋值给其它变量,或者作为参数传递给函数,方法或类实例,或者被赋值为一个窗口对象的成员,该对象的一个新的引用或者称别名,...x是第一个引用,该对象的引用计数设置为 1 。当y = x 语句执行时,并没有为y创建一个新对象,而是该对象的引用计数增加了1次。这是引用计数的增加。

39520

Python基础(1):基本规则及赋值「建议收藏」

File "", line 1 y = (x = x + 1) ^ SyntaxError: invalid syntax >>> if (a = 3): SyntaxError: invalid...File "", line 1 y = (x = x + 1) ^ SyntaxError: invalid syntax >>> if (a = 3): SyntaxError: invalid...使用多元赋值的方法可以不使用中间变量直接交换表量的值 >>> x , y = 1, 2 >>> x, y (1, 2) >>> x, y = y, x >>> x, y (2, 1) 专用下划线标识符...当对象被创建并赋值给变量,该对象的引用计数就被设置为 1 当同一个对象又被赋值给其它变量,或者作为参数传递给函数,方法或类实例,或者被赋值为一个窗口对象的成员,该对象的一个新的引用或者称别名,就被创建...x是第一个引用,该对象的引用计数设置为 1 。当y = x 语句执行时,并没有为y创建一个新对象,而是该对象的引用计数增加了1次。这是引用计数的增加。

65820
  • 7种你应该知道的JavaScript常见的错误

    从浏览器的控制台到运行Node.js的计算机终端,我们到处都会看到各类错误。 这篇文章的重点是概述我们在JS开发过程中可能遇到的错误类型。 1....can't find it 注意:未定义的变量不会抛出ReferenceError,因为它存在于环境记录中只是它的值尚未设置。 3. SyntaxError 这是我们遇到的最常见的错误。...在标记化和解析这两个阶段,如果我们代码的语法不符合JS的语法规则,则会使执行阶段失败并引发SyntaxError。...例如, const l = console.log let cat h =“ cat” 这里的“h”明显是多余的,所以由于多了这个字符,会导致引擎抛出SyntaxError $ node errors...errors.js:3 let cat h = "cat" ^ SyntaxError: Unexpected identifier 很显然,Node.js引擎发现了错误,由于这个不和谐字符的出现

    2.6K10

    2.9K Star开源一款类似crontab的工具,带UI界面

    它提供实时统计数据和实时日志查看器的功能。Cronicle可以接收简单的shell命令,也支持使用各种编程语言编写插件。...功能特点 1.单服务器或多服务器设置:Cronicle支持在单个服务器或多台服务器上运行任务,可以轻松配置和管理服务器。...2.自动故障转移到备份服务器:当主服务器发生故障,Cronicle能够自动切换到备份服务器,确保任务的连续运行。...4.实时任务状态与实时日志查看器:通过Cronicle的用户界面,你可以实时查看任务的状态和日志,了解任务的进度以及输出的详细信息。...使用步骤: 1.安装Node.js和npm:确保你已经安装了Node.js 8.0及以上版本以及npm 5.0及以上版本。

    1.1K10

    腾讯安全威胁情报中心推出2024年3月必修安全漏洞清单

    当漏洞综合评估为风险严重、影响面较广、技术细节已披露,且被安全社区高度关注,就将该漏洞列入必修安全漏洞候选清单。...【备注】:建议您在升级前做好数据备份工作,避免出现意外。...成功利用此漏洞的攻击者,最终可进行内网探测、读取敏感信息、恶意流量伪造等操作。...当用户执行请求,会话 cookie 的值pga4_session会被用于检索文件,然后反序列化其内容,最后验证其签名。攻击者可以通过发送特制的请求触发反序列化,最终远程执行任意代码。...临时缓解方案 - 关闭任务中心,任务中心的位置为:系统设置-功能设置-任务中心。

    63710

    你一定遇到过Python中的无效语法:SyntaxError---常见原因以及解决办法

    这些词在代码中不能用作标识符、变量或函数名。它们是语言的一部分,只能在Python允许的上下文中使用。...syntax 当您试图为pass分配一个值,或者当您试图定义一个名为pass的新函数,您将得到一个SyntaxError并再次看到“无效语法”消息。...根据您的系统设置,这个代码块在您看来可能是完美的,也可能是完全错误的。 但是,Python会立即注意到这个问题。...标签宽度的变化,基于标签宽度的设置: 如果制表符宽度为4,那么print语句看起来就像是在for循环之外。控制台将在循环结束打印“done”。...下一次出现SyntaxError,您就可以更好地快速修复这个问题了!

    27.7K20

    从零开始学python

    .下载安装包 https://www.python.org/downloads/ 选择自己合适的包下载 2.安装,一路next即可 3.配置环境变量 【右键计算机】–》【属性】–》【高级系统设置...注意:如果你使用编辑器,同时需要设置 py 文件存储的格式为 UTF-8,否则会出现类似以下错误信息: SyntaxError: (unicode error) ‘utf-8’ codec can’t...; Python 标识符 在 Python 里,标识符由字母、数字、下划线组成。 在 Python 中,所有标识符可以包括英文、数字以及下划线(_),但不能以数字开头。...Python 中的标识符是区分大小写的。 以下划线开头的标识符是有特殊意义的。...书写不插入空行,Python解释器运行也不会出错。但是空行的作用在于分隔两段不同功能或含义的代码,便于日后代码的维护或重构。 记住:空行也是程序代码的一部分。

    60520

    Spring Security入门3:Web应用程序中的常见安全漏洞

    攻击者向用户发送一个包含有效会话标识符的恶意链接,当用户点击链接并进行身份验证,会话标识符就被固定在用户的会话中。攻击者通过篡改用户的URL,将有效的会话标识符插入其中。...用户输入用户名和密码进行身份验证,会话标识符也会被提交到服务器进行验证。 由于用户在点击恶意链接后,会话标识符已经被设置并传递到用户会话中,服务器认为该会话是有效的并与用户的身份相关联。...HTTP头部设置设置合适的Content-Security-Policy(CSP)和X-XSS-Protection头部,以增强浏览器的安全性。...发送伪造请求:用户在访问恶意网站B,恶意网站会自动发送针对目标网站A的请求,利用用户之前在网站A上获得的有效会话凭证。这样,目标网站A会认为这个请求是用户的合法请求,执行相应的操作。...设置SameSite属性:将Cookie的SameSite属性设置为Strict或Lax,限制跨域请求携带Cookie,阻止部分CSRF攻击。

    40980

    你应该知道的7 个 JavaScript 原生错误类型

    从浏览器控制台到运行 Node.js 的终端,我们到处都会看到错误。 本文的重点是概述我们在 JS 开发过程中可能遇到的错误类型。 ---- 1....当在记录中找到环境值并提取并返回值,将以该变量的名称作为关键字在环境记录进行搜索。调用尚未定义的函数。 现在,当我们创建或定义一个没有赋值的变量。...can't find it 注意:未定义的变量不会抛出 ReferenceError,因为它在于环境记录中的值尚未设置。 3. SyntaxError 这是最常见的错误。...在标记化和解析这两个阶段,如果我们代码的语法不符合 JS 的语法规则,则会使该阶段失败并引发 SyntaxError。...1$ node errors 2errors.js:3 3let cat h = "cat" 4 ^SyntaxError: Unexpected identifier 看,Node.js 指出了问题的所在

    2.7K20

    Spring Security入门3:Web应用程序中的常见安全漏洞

    攻击者向用户发送一个包含有效会话标识符的恶意链接,当用户点击链接并进行身份验证,会话标识符就被固定在用户的会话中。攻击者通过篡改用户的URL,将有效的会话标识符插入其中。...用户输入用户名和密码进行身份验证,会话标识符也会被提交到服务器进行验证。 由于用户在点击恶意链接后,会话标识符已经被设置并传递到用户会话中,服务器认为该会话是有效的并与用户的身份相关联。...HTTP头部设置设置合适的Content-Security-Policy(CSP)和X-XSS-Protection头部,以增强浏览器的安全性。...发送伪造请求:用户在访问恶意网站B,恶意网站会自动发送针对目标网站A的请求,利用用户之前在网站A上获得的有效会话凭证。这样,目标网站A会认为这个请求是用户的合法请求,执行相应的操作。...设置SameSite属性:将Cookie的SameSite属性设置为Strict或Lax,限制跨域请求携带Cookie,阻止部分CSRF攻击。

    36260

    Node.js生态系统的隐藏属性滥用攻击

    使用这个向量,攻击者可以伪造许多内置属性,甚至嵌套的原型属性(发现的两个漏洞是使用嵌套属性来利用的)。如有必要,他们还可以伪造其他原型属性,例如constructor.name。...特别是,静态分析可以轻松获得目标程序的全貌,但通常会引入很高的误报,尤其是在处理指向和回调问题,发现这种情况在 Node.js 程序中非常常见。...为此,通过拦截所有变量读/写操作来检测目标 Node.js 程序。当这样的操作发生在一个内部对象上,LYNX 会递归地检查这个对象的所有属性和子属性。...使用 HP-13,恶意对象可以伪造为一个非常长的数组。...如List 2 所示,程序通过用户提供的秘密标识符 (id) 加载/删除用户配置文件。通过滥用所讨论的漏洞,攻击者可以强制数据库返回有效用户,而不管标识符是否正确。

    20320

    针对 QUIC协议的客户端请求伪造攻击

    本文详细研究了 QUIC 中的客户端请求伪造,并提供了首个可行性分析。在由 QUIC 客户端(攻击者)发起请求伪造攻击,请求伪造会导致 QUIC 服务器(受害者)发送攻击者控制的数据包。...系统和威胁模型 当攻击者能够触发主机(受害者)向另一台主机(目标)发送一个或多个“意外”网络请求,就会发生请求伪造攻击,这是通过滥用协议功能或滥用应用程序逻辑缺陷来实现的。...数据包号长度之后的字段以四个字节对版本标识符进行编码。尽管此值是动态的并且可以由攻击者设置,但它必须是服务器理解的预定义版本以避免触发版本协商。...然而,将两个 Add 字节设置为 0x0001,以处理 CID 、之后的版本协商数据包的剩余版本号标识符。...不同的互操作性设置和对攻击场景的响应为 13 个开源实现中的每一个创建了一组分离的标识符。特别是连接迁移行为可能是对现有方法的有价值的补充。

    1.5K40

    【已解决】Vue项目中Vite以及Webpack代码混淆处理

    reservedNames保留的标识符名字列表。reservedStrings保留的字符串列表。seed用于生成随机数的种子。selfDefending如果设置为 true,将启用自我保护模式。...注意,当项目比较庞大,不建议开启膨胀,也就是deadCodeInjection取值为false,不需要设置deadCodeInjectionThreshold的值三、Vite混淆处理可能会出现的异常问题...1、Uncaught SyntaxError: Unexpected token '<'打包之后,部署到服务器后,控制台报错:Uncaught SyntaxError: Unexpected token...//全局标识符添加特定前缀,在混淆同一页面上加载的多个文件使用此选项。...reservedStrings: [], // 通过固定和随机(在代码混淆生成)的位置移动数组。

    2.9K42

    你必须掌握的 7 种 JavaScript 错误类型

    从浏览器控制台到运行Node.js的计算机终端,我们到处都会看到错误。 这篇文章重点介绍了在JS开发过程中可能遇到的 7 种错误类型。...can't find it 注意:未定义的变量不会抛出ReferenceError,因为它存在于环境记录中只是它的值尚未设置。...1 3.SyntaxError 语法错误 这是我们遇到的最常见的错误。 当我们键入JS引擎可以理解的代码,会发生此错误。 解析期间,JS引擎捕获了此错误。...在这两个阶段,即标记化和解析,如果我们代码的语法/源不符合JS的语法规则,则会使阶段失败并引发SyntaxError。...let cat h = "cat" ^ SyntaxError: Unexpected identifie 因此,我们可以说语法错误发生在解析/编译期间。

    4.1K10
    领券